I didn't see Pele or any others of that era in their prime, but as I tend to do when stacking up the greats is to measure if they changed the game, or how it is/was being played.

Deep down, without much to go on, I have always thought of Beckenbauer as doing this.  When he was no longer fast enough he created his own position which was used for 20 years before the Brazilians took the world by storm with the flat back 4.

But Pele played back when the ball was akin to a pumpkin.  Over the past 20 years they have gone to the sealed seams to promote knuckling as well as increase the velocity of the ball 15% from the Tangos of the 80's, so Messi absolutely has that advantage.  Whether 80% of all goals are scored inside the penalty mark, just having the ability to shoot from further out is a big deal because it requires the defense to step up sooner creating more space.

Maradona was always tough for me.  I don't think I ever, and I mean ever, saw him touch the ball with his right foot unless it couldn't be helped and I always thought the best players had to be capable with both feet.

Then comes Platini and Zidane, they were wizards.  So was Cryuff.  It is really the impossible question, but I asked the question so I have to stick my oar in, though like MShills, it is simply opinion:

 

Messi, if not for any other reason than longevity of production, but I could pick a lot of folks.

I think there are some differences though with the NHL.  It's only relatively recently that NHL players were playing in that tournament, whereas the world cup has been happening for 80 years.  

 

The NHL owners don't want the Olympics under the conditions the IOC imposes.  Namely, the NHL cannot use any images from any games to promote the sport, and secondly(or firstly depending on your POV), the owners are expected to shoulder any insurance costs.  Given the contracts some guys have, you're looking at millions in insurance premiums.  So the owner is expected to give up his player for a time, run the risk of injury(ask the Islanders if they would have rather than John Tavares healthy for the rest of 2014 season, or if the insurance made it ok), pay that fee, all for the ability to not use anything from that tournament.  There's a saying about not using any lube that fits here.

 

Soccer has always had this as part of the equation.  I'd be curious to know if the leagues are willing to consider this.  Given the turf wars breaking out in soccer(UEFA threatening to break away from FIFA), who knows what will happen.  I know I watched more because I have been inside more than I would be in summer, but that's n=1.

 

Tough to say on Messi.  Tough to hold not winning the world cup against a guy, given a)you need to be born in a country that is strong in soccer, and then b)the team needs to be good.  But holy crap, is that man a magician with the ball on his foot.
